Evan Longoria 12x15 Premium Fan Cave Plaque
Longoria is the face of the franchise, full stop. He was the Rookie of the Year in 2008, a three-time Gold Glover, and the guy who hit that walk-off homer in the final game of the 2011 season to keep the Rays alive. This premium 12x15 plaque holds eight of his licensed trading cards, making it a serious piece for any Rays fan cave.
